A few Minor Problems, Help Please!

I have a 93 R1(90k miles, Manual), and it's having some small mechanical issues. Now before I start, I have checked through plenty of threads on this forum and after becoming frustrated, decided to post my own - so here goes.

Idle

My car has stalled a couple of times, never when its cold, and typically when its been running for a little while. It usually happens when I engage the clutch and put it into neutral, or 1st/2nd. It's happened once when I was at a red light, once in my driveway, and once when I was coming off the Interstate. It only started acting this way here in the past couple of weeks and has always run fine other than this. Any ideas? I know it could be a lot of different things - but it sounds to me like a fuel issue, I just don't know where to start in searching for it.

Coolant Sensor

The coolant sensor is always going off, with that emminating 'beeeeeeeeeeeeep'. I have a full tank of coolant, so I imagine the sensor is bad. Where is it, and what do I need to do in order to fix it?

Fuel Filter

This might have something to do with the stalling problems - but I contacted the original owner a few nights ago and he suggested that he doesn't remember the last time the fuel filter was changed, only that it was. Is there a good place I could order one online, instead of having to pay the ridiculous $100+ for one from a dealer? Something some of you guys trust and use.

I cant answer your question about the fuel filter fully cause Ive never had to change mine yet. But for your idle...does it seem to be in a good range most of the time when its just sitting there? It should be around 800 or so...If its not, just adjust it using the screw on the throttle body. Then, the coolant sensor is on the coolant filler neck. On the front side, down about 5inches or so. It has a black wire comming out of it. These do go bad every once in a while, so theres a good chance thats it. Good luck.

First, where are you checking the coolant level from? Are you checking the overflow tank or the filler neck? Check the filler neck (of course, not while the car is hot):



If the coolant is not near the top of the filler neck, then that's the problem (and may be a much bigger problem).

If coolant is at near the top of the filler neck, check to make sure the wire is not damaged to the level sensor. The level sensor is on the front of the t-stat housing below the filler neck cap.
